Half-life of a radioactive substance is 18 minutes. The time interval between its \(20 \%\) decay and \(80 \%\) decay in minutes is

  1. A 6
  2. B 9
  3. C 18
  4. D 36
Verified Solution

Answer & Solution

Correct Answer

(D) 36

Step-by-step Solution

Detailed explanation

After \(n\) half-life, the numbers of atom left undecayed is given by, \(\begin{aligned} & N=N_0\left(\frac{1}{2}\right)^n \\ & n=\frac{t}{T_{\frac{1}{2}}} \text { or } N=N_0\left(\frac{1}{2}\right)^{\frac{t}{T_{1 / 2}}} \end{aligned}\) For \(20 \%\) decay of radioactive…
